About Wroxall Abbey Hotel & Estate

Wroxall Abbey Hotel & Estate is perfectly located for both business and leisure guests in Birmingham. The hotel offers a high standard of service and amenities to suit the individual needs of all travelers. Service-minded staff will welcome and guide you at the Wroxall Abbey Hotel & Estate. Each guestroom is elegantly furnished and equipped with handy amenities. Access to the hotel's hot tub, fitness center, sauna, indoor pool, spa will further enhance your satisfying stay. I recently got married at Wroxall and there were an array of issues. Clearly, they don’t seem to be able to organise weddings well because even their wedding coordinator left and I was left with a member of the sales team who didn’t really know what to do either - especially when it came to organising a document needed for serving alcohol. At one point, I didn’t know whether I was going to be able to serve all the alcohol I’d paid for because of their incompetence.

The marquee doesn’t get washed so it was a bit of a state. I was lucky that my decor team did such an amazing job to hide all their issues, including their awful flooring and chairs.

During the evening, the lighting wouldn’t work so my guests were in near darkness and even when we went to complain, there was no one around. Honestly, the customs service was horrendous.

The toilets weren’t even looked at - despite having an event there all day!

We then had issues at checkout - we ended up paying twice for things that had already been paid for and now that I’m trying to chase things up, no one gets back to you.

I’ve complained before and after the wedding and I’m still waiting for a response - the worst customer service I’ve ever had to deal with.

The hotel is set in beautiful grounds. The staff, although not enough, are incredibly polite and courteous. Dinner was amazing, with waiters rushing to fill your wine glass when needed. What let the hotel down in my opinion was the lack of staff to meet you at breakfast. Guests came in, with no idea what to do, with room numbers not checked, infact anyone could have wandered in without paying and the hotel probably loses a lot of money in this way. The spa was filthy; we reported it to reception but it was still messy the following morning, with discarded swimming trunks still on the floor together with towels and slippers from the spa just abandoned as the linen basket was overflowing with used towels.
It's such a shame as the hotel is absolutely beautiful and could do so much better with a few simple changes

We visited for a Ladies spa weekend. This was a second visit. The spa facilities are excellent with pool, steam room, jacuzzi and sauna. There are lots of beauty treatments available which need to be booked and Espa products are used. Food is available at any time and is of a high standard. The hotel is large and needs updating but is very comfortable and clean.
